    We regret to advise of the death of Donald Ronald McKay of St Peter’s NS on 17 February 2009 in Richmond Villa St Peter”s at the age of 97 years.

    Donald was born in Kingsville NS and grew up in Inverness County. He started his working life in the mines of Quebec and Northern Ontario and when the war broke out, he joined the 1st Field Company, Royal Canadian Engineers.  After the war, he settled in Brantford ON where he worked for 3M Corporation. He later moved to Moncton NB and worked for the Canadian National Railway.  After he retired, he moved back to St. Peter's. 

    Donald was a fluent Gaelic speaker and had vast knowledge of Scottish history, Scottish lore and most especially, family ancestry. He became a member of St. Peter's Parish and St. Anthony's Guild. He was a life membership in the CN Pensioner's Club. He belonged to the Clan MacKay Society and the Order of Good Cheer.
